How to maintain a cast iron skillet with enamel exterior in humid climates?

Ensure the skillet is completely dried after washing. While the enamel protects the exterior, keeping the cooking surface clean and dry prevents any moisture buildup in the pores of the iron.

Why choose enamel-coated iron over raw cast iron for East African markets?

Enamel eliminates the need for constant seasoning and provides a critical barrier against rust, which is highly beneficial in humid tropical regions.
